Precautions
Conrm the following items before using a Memory Card. Refer to the CS/CJ/NSJ Series Programmable Controller Programming Manual (W394)
for details.
Format
The Memory Cards are already formatted when shipped; there is no need to format them again after purchase. To format a Memory C ard that
has been used, always format it in the CPU Unit using the CX-Programmer or a Programming Console. You will not be able to use a Memory
Card in the CPU Unit if you format it on a personal computer of in an SPU Unit.
Write Life
Flash memory can be written only a limited number of times. The guaranteed limit for writing to a Memory Card is set at 100,000 writes. That
means if you write to a Memory Card continuously once every 10 minutes, you will exceed 100,000 writes in two years.
Minimum File Size
If many small les, such as ones containing only a few words of DM Area data, are stored on a Memory Card, the Memory Card wil l become
full sooner than expected. For example, for a Memory Card with an allocation unit size set to 2,048 bytes, a single le will a lways use 2,048
bytes of space on the Memory Card no matter how little data it contains.
Precautions during Memory Card Access
The BUSY indicator on the CPU Unit will light when the Memory Card is being accessed.
1. Never turn OFF the power to the PLC while the BUSY indicator is lit.
2. Never remove the Memory Card while the BUSY indicator is lit.Before removing a Memory Card, press the button to stop power su pply to
the Memory Card and wait for the BUSY indicator to go out. It may become impossible to use the Memory Card if either the power is turned
OFF or the Memory Card is removed while the Memory Card is being accessed.
3. Several seconds are sometimes required for the CPU Unit to detect the Memory Card after the the Memory Card is inserted. The ti
me
required will depend on the cycle time of the PLC, the Memory Card capacity, the number of les on the Memory Card, and other factors.
When accessing a Memory Card, use the Memory Card Detected Flag (A34315) in a NO input condition for the instruction accessing the
Memory Card. Refer to the CS/CJ/NSJ Series Programmable Controller Programming Manual (W394) for a programming example.
Precaution when Inserting a Memory Card
The direction the Memory Card must face when it is inserted depends on the model of CPU Unit that is used. With a CS-series CPU Unit, the
label on the Memory Card must face to the right. If a Memory Card is forced into the slot when it is facing the wrong direction , the CPU Unit or
Memory Card may be damaged and fail to operate properly.
Item Model HMC-EF183
Common
specications
Memory capacity 128 MB
Dimensions 42.8 36.4 3.3 mm (W H T)
Weight 15 g max.
Current consumption Approx. 30 mA (when used with PLC)
Application/storage environment Same a general specications of PLC
No. of writes 100,000 (guaranteed value)
Factory
specications
No. of les writable to root directory 511
File system FAT16
Files that can be stored when mounted in CS/CJ-series PLC or
NSJ Controller (See note.)
1. Program les
2. Parameter les
3. Data les
4. Conversion table les
5. Comment les
6. Program index les
7. Unit/Board backup les
